Medupi receives critical DoL registration for first boiler

Further advancing the project toward its December 24 synchronisation date, power utility Eskom’s Medupi power station project, in Limpopo, has received the Pressure Equipment Regulation Certificate of Registration for Unit 6 – the first Medupi boiler set to be connected to the national electricity grid.

The utility said in a project update on Friday that no user may use a steam generator, or boiler, unless it was in possession of a certificate of registration from the Department of Labour (DoL).

“The process and procedures normally required to achieve this major milestone were accelerated through the establishment of a strong relationship between senior DoL members and Medupi project leaders prior to the submission,” it stated.

Medupi was now ready for its first oil fire, which was scheduled for Friday.
